Dental implant study seeks best numbing technique for less pain
Symptom relief OngoingThis study compares two ways to numb the jaw for placing dental implants in the back lower teeth: a nerve block versus local infiltration. Dental implant showdown: which design saves more bone?
Knowledge-focused OngoingThis study compares two similar dental implants from the same brand—one placed at the bone level and one at the soft tissue level—to see which one leads to less bone loss around the implant.
